我希望能够在扩展程序中更改SoundCloud视频的进度。
我一直在考虑的可能性:
在YouTube上有一个<video>
元素,用于处理HTMLMediaElement界面交互。在SC上,没有这样的元素(即<audio>
或<video>
),因此调用类似$('audio').currentTime = 100
的内容是不可能的。另一方面,SC在JS中使用 HTMLMediaElement ,它似乎创建了一个Audio对象并在其上调用了适当的 HTMLMediaElement 函数。请注意,Chrome扩展程序无法调用网页的脚本。
模拟进度条任意给定部分的点击,以便视频跳转到正确的位置。它需要指定适当的x,y坐标。它有可能吗?
请分享您的想法。以上任何选项都可以吗?